Hermeus is a high-speed aircraft manufacturer focused on the rapid design, build, and test of high-Mach and hypersonic aircraft for the national interest. Working directly with the Department of Defense, Hermeus delivers capabilities that will ensure that our nation, and our allies, maintain an asymmetric advantage over any and all potential adversaries. Hermeus is seeking a highly hands-on, curious, and resourceful Platform Intern to support our Mission Systems Engineering team. This role is ideal for a “builder”, someone who enjoys working across hardware, software, networking, and physical systems, and isn’t afraid to pick up tools and figure things out. You’ll work at the intersection of IT infrastructure, flight systems, and real-world operations — supporting everything from ground control stations and networks to custom hardware setups and test environments.
